Troy fans had a lot of people in bars and hospitality workers ask who they were and why they were there ("Oh yeah, the New Orleans Bowl!") and were so many of them around. They were happily surprised at the turnout for a game that New Orleans, apparently, mostly ignores.
That said, it's a great game, facilities (the Dome is a marvel), town and party atmosphere. It was my best time ever at a bowl game (better than the Peach Bowl, for sure … Silicon Valley in San Jose had some nice fan events and a beautiful downtown with party spots, ice skating etc.). But the locals did not make much of an impact in NOLA (or San Jose). The crowd was pretty evenly split between Troy and Rice and the attendance was around 27,000.
There was a real buzz this year amongst Troy fans who missed it last year. A Troy official told me they were prepared to sell 25,000 tickets to the game, which would have made it the best NOB ever.
